The meaning(s) of ARMIN:
The name Armin is a Teutonic baby name. In Teutonic the meaning of the name Armin is: warrior.
The name Armin is a Hebrew baby name. In Hebrew the meaning of the name Armin is: High place.
The name Armin is a German baby name. In German the meaning of the name Armin is: Protective.Also can be aSoldier.Army Man.
USA birth(s) for ARMIN by year:
Here is the latest 16 years from USA social security list of total babies born with the name ARMIN
ARMIN as a boy
| Year | Boy Births |
|---|---|
| 2024 | 79 births |
| 2023 | 84 births |
| 2022 | 78 births |
| 2021 | 69 births |
| 2020 | 52 births |
| 2019 | 63 births |
| 2018 | 61 births |
| 2017 | 63 births |
| 2016 | 70 births |
| 2015 | 63 births |
| 2014 | 60 births |
| 2013 | 53 births |
| 2012 | 49 births |
| 2011 | 45 births |
| 2010 | 48 births |
| 2009 | 42 births |
| 2008 | 57 births |
| 2007 | 41 births |
| 2006 | 43 births |
| 2005 | 49 births |
| 2004 | 52 births |
| 2003 | 59 births |
| 2002 | 39 births |
| 2001 | 54 births |
| 2000 | 42 births |
| 1999 | 45 births |
| 1998 | 42 births |
| 1997 | 45 births |
| 1996 | 31 births |
| 1995 | 30 births |
| 1994 | 20 births |
| 1993 | 18 births |
